如何为AI语音聊天添加语音指令扩展功能
在人工智能技术飞速发展的今天,AI语音聊天已经成为了我们生活中不可或缺的一部分。然而,随着用户需求的不断增长,单一的语音聊天功能已经无法满足用户的需求。为了提升用户体验,许多开发者开始为AI语音聊天添加语音指令扩展功能。本文将讲述一位AI语音聊天开发者如何为产品添加语音指令扩展功能的故事。
故事的主人公名叫小明,他是一位年轻而有才华的AI语音聊天开发者。小明从小就对计算机有着浓厚的兴趣,大学毕业后,他进入了一家知名互联网公司从事AI语音聊天产品的研发工作。经过几年的努力,小明所在团队研发的AI语音聊天产品在市场上取得了良好的口碑。
然而,随着市场竞争的加剧,小明发现他们的产品在功能上与竞争对手相比存在一定的差距。为了提升产品的竞争力,小明决定为AI语音聊天添加语音指令扩展功能。以下是小明为产品添加语音指令扩展功能的全过程。
一、需求分析
在开始开发语音指令扩展功能之前,小明首先对市场需求进行了深入分析。他发现,用户在使用AI语音聊天产品时,除了基本的聊天功能外,还需要以下几方面的需求:
智能语音助手:用户希望AI语音聊天产品能够提供智能语音助手功能,如查询天气、设置闹钟、提醒事项等。
娱乐功能:用户希望在聊天过程中能够享受到音乐、笑话、故事等娱乐内容。
个性化定制:用户希望AI语音聊天产品能够根据个人喜好提供个性化的聊天内容。
实用工具:用户希望AI语音聊天产品能够提供一些实用工具,如计算器、翻译器等。
二、技术选型
在确定了用户需求后,小明开始对技术选型进行深入研究。他了解到,目前市场上主流的语音指令扩展技术主要有以下几种:
语音识别技术:通过将用户的语音转换为文字,实现语音指令的识别。
语音合成技术:将文字转换为语音,实现语音指令的输出。
自然语言处理技术:对用户的语音指令进行分析和理解,实现智能对话。
云服务技术:通过云计算平台提供语音指令扩展功能。
综合考虑各种技术特点,小明决定采用以下技术方案:
使用主流的语音识别和语音合成技术,确保语音指令的准确性和流畅性。
利用自然语言处理技术,实现智能对话功能。
基于云服务技术,为用户提供便捷的语音指令扩展功能。
三、功能开发
在确定了技术方案后,小明开始着手开发语音指令扩展功能。以下是功能开发过程中的关键步骤:
语音识别和语音合成模块:小明首先开发了语音识别和语音合成模块,实现了语音指令的输入和输出。
自然语言处理模块:接着,小明开发了自然语言处理模块,对用户的语音指令进行分析和理解,实现智能对话。
云服务模块:小明利用云服务技术,将语音指令扩展功能部署在云端,为用户提供便捷的服务。
用户界面设计:为了提升用户体验,小明对用户界面进行了精心设计,使得用户能够轻松地使用语音指令扩展功能。
四、测试与优化
在功能开发完成后,小明对产品进行了严格的测试。他邀请了多位用户参与测试,收集用户反馈,并对产品进行优化。以下是测试与优化过程中的关键步骤:
功能测试:小明对语音指令扩展功能进行了全面的功能测试,确保各项功能正常运行。
性能测试:小明对产品的性能进行了测试,确保语音指令扩展功能在高速网络环境下也能流畅运行。
用户体验测试:小明邀请用户对语音指令扩展功能进行体验,收集用户反馈,对产品进行优化。
五、上线与推广
经过多次测试和优化,小明终于将语音指令扩展功能正式上线。为了推广这项功能,他采取了一系列措施:
制作宣传视频:小明制作了精美的宣传视频,介绍了语音指令扩展功能的特点和优势。
社交媒体推广:小明在各大社交媒体平台上发布宣传信息,吸引更多用户关注。
合作伙伴推广:小明与合作伙伴建立了良好的合作关系,共同推广语音指令扩展功能。
经过一段时间的推广,语音指令扩展功能取得了显著的成果。用户对这项功能好评如潮,产品在市场上的竞争力得到了进一步提升。
总结
通过为AI语音聊天添加语音指令扩展功能,小明成功提升了产品的竞争力,为用户带来了更好的体验。这个故事告诉我们,在人工智能时代,开发者应紧跟市场需求,不断创新,为用户提供更优质的产品和服务。
猜你喜欢:AI聊天软件